“Rock am Ring” cautions attendees with KATWARN

News from May 25, 2016

At the music festival “Rock am Ring” to be held from the 3rd to the 5th of June this year in Mendig, around 90,000 guests are expected. Commencing this year, in order to be better protected in the event of storms or other disturbances to security a special application of the alerting system KATWARN is at your disposal free of cost.

Last year severe storms passed over the grounds of the festival “Rock am Ring” in Mendig: 33 people were injured due to lightning strikes and the stage was partially severely damaged. In order to react quicker and to give the visitors to the festival warning messages and advice on how to react, the local civil protection and disaster response in the county of Mayen-Koblenz will use a special application of the alerting App “KATWARN” for smartphones.

KATWARN is an App for mobile telephones that has been in service since September 2015 in the county Mayen-Koblenz. An especially tailor-made version for the music festival will additionally inform participants and visitors of the music festival about security relevant incidents on the grounds of the festival grounds and will provide first directives for action. The App was developed by the Fraunhofer Institute FOKUS in Berlin on behalf of the public insurers. The technical platform is provided by Provinzial Rheinland together with the association of public insurers.

Users of smartphones (iOS, Android, Windows) can download the KATWARN-APP free of cost from the App Store, Google Play Store or the Microsoft Store respectively and can consign the theme “Themen-Abo Rock am Ring” via weblink or can activate it via the QR-Code.
